Transaction df17398526431c96a93a62ac3c5a77b11f58d6b22961ba57be697b7059640e74

block
c3afd3963125f03ccd2f5fa14d8aeafd151b59fe4e1b2563eb5a7495f19e225a

96 Inputs

132 Outputs